当前位置: 首页 > news >正文

广州网营广告有限公司上海关键词优化外包

广州网营广告有限公司,上海关键词优化外包,网站开发与设计 信科,上海市住房与城乡建设部网站前不久做的一个项目,需要在前端实时展示硬件设备的数据。设备很多,并且每个设备的数据也很多,总之就是数据很多。同时,设备的刷新频率很快,需要每2秒读取一遍数据。 问题来了,我们如何读取数据&#xff0c…

前不久做的一个项目,需要在前端实时展示硬件设备的数据。设备很多,并且每个设备的数据也很多,总之就是数据很多。同时,设备的刷新频率很快,需要每2秒读取一遍数据。

问题来了,我们如何读取数据,并且在前端展示?

我的想法是利用多级缓存:
1)首先是有个数据采集程序,不停地采集设备的数据。采集到数据以后,写入redis的1号库;
2)WEB后端设置一个定时器,每2秒读一次redids的1号库,处理后写入redis的2号库。之所以要处理一下,是因为1号库的数据比较原始,处理后才适合前端处理
3)前端也设置一个程序,每2秒向后端请求一次数据,后端将redis#2数据返回;前端收到数据后写入前端缓存。我们前端是用vue搞的,所以存入store。
4)前端由很多个组件构成,每个组件都从store中读取数据,然后展示。

系统结构如图所示:
在这里插入图片描述
优点:
1)数据采集程序与WEB前后端解耦,职责单一,除了采集数据,啥都不用管。简单的往往就是最好的,不容易出错
2)后端定期处理原始数据,将结果缓存,当前端请求时,返回缓存中的该结果,减少重复劳动,提高了性能
3)前端虽有多个组件,但不是每一个组件都向后端请求,而是统一请求一次,存入前端缓存,然后全部组件都从前端缓存中读取,对性能是一个保障。

事实证明,这种多级缓存机制下,前端展示数据非常迅速,及时。虽然前端和WEB后端之间没有使用websocket进行数据传输,而是使用了最笨的定期获取,但丝毫没有影响前端的用户体验。

http://www.hrbkazy.com/news/54662.html

相关文章:

  • 网站建设费摊多久电话投放小网站
  • wordpress插件dedecms推广优化工具
  • 专做mad的网站百度高级搜索网址
  • 做网站程序的都不关注seo微信视频号小店
  • 网站的空间和域名备案吗网络营销题库及答案2020
  • 怎么在网上做彩票网站热搜榜排名今日
  • 哪个网站做欧洲旅游攻略好windows系统优化软件排行榜
  • 福建省人民政府副省长分工广州网站运营专注乐云seo
  • div+css网络公司网站模板南宁百度推广seo
  • 瀑布流响应式网站模板国外b站不收费免费2023
  • 城市网站建设意义代运营一个月多少钱
  • 免费域名注册和免费建站百度竞价推广方案范文
  • 如何做企业套模网站百度网站认证
  • 微信公众号网站导航怎么做目前推广软件
  • 怎么做网业页江苏网站seo设计
  • 网站蜘蛛池怎么做的北京网站优化步骤
  • 建设网站都要什么全网推广软件
  • 产品展示型网站免费域名申请网站大全
  • 付费网站搭建申请网站怎样申请
  • 汕头网站制作好用的种子搜索引擎
  • 网站的组成衡水seo排名
  • 能用二级域名做网站吗营销公司排名
  • 长沙旅游攻略美食站长工具seo综合查询论坛
  • 上海专业的网站建百度网络营销中心官网
  • 深圳市网站建设公司好不好百度推广怎么收费
  • 免费网站建设免代码快手秒赞秒评网站推广
  • 网站空白栏目监管附近的教育培训机构有哪些
  • 禁忌网站有哪些百度云登陆首页
  • 网站建设服务杭州seo和sem的概念
  • 计算机专业代做毕设哪个网站靠谱今日重大军事新闻